Let \(L\) be a tangent line to the parabola \(y^{2}=4 x-20\) at \((6,2)\) . If \(L\) is also a tangent to the ellipse \(\frac{ x ^{2}}{2}+\frac{ y ^{2}}{ b }=1,\) then the value of \(b\) is equal to ..... .

  1. A \(11\)
  2. B \(14\)
  3. C \(16\)
  4. D \(20\)
Verified Solution

Answer & Solution

Correct Answer

(B) \(14\)

Step-by-step Solution

Detailed explanation

Tangent to parabola \(2 y=2(x+6)-20\) \(\Rightarrow y=x-4\) Condition of tangency for ellipse. \(16=2(1)^{2}+ b\) \(\Rightarrow b =14\)
